In these dreadful days of coronavirus destruction and disruption, a group of medical doctors, of the Catholic faith, have chosen to offer their services, online, to the public free of charge.
This was made known in the statement issued by the V-Consultation Volunteer Corps of the Association of Catholic Medical Practitioners of Nigeria.
It further stated that Christians of the Catholic denomination would be more favoured.
In the statement, the doctors stated that they have “volunteered to provide virtual counseling and consultation to members of the public especially Catholics who may need medical attention during this period of lockdown.”
One of the challenges being experienced in the global battle against the covid-19 pandemic is the growing shortage of doctors and other healthcare workers.
In Nigeria, the rate, of infections and confirmed cases of the virus, is threatening to collapse the Nigerians health sector and soon so many more doctors will be desperately needed and sought after.
This offer by the Catholic doctors has come at a time when such services are a soul-saver for a country in crisis of covid-19.
